With a terrifying, unnatural creature laying siege to the town of Boroma, it’s unclear how anyone will survive…

This is a one-shot adventure beginning at level 4, designed for a party of four. It should take approximately 10 hours to play. The adventure is a light, roleplay heavy adventure that culminates with a large-scale combat to save the town of Boroma. They must use problem solving skills to find the best tools and gain the right allies to finally take on a creature before it can break through the walls and claim the city. The adventure features a number of magic items that can be found or bought, as well as a prize for completing the quest.

*GMs eyes only below*

The adventure begins with the party being introduced to Chancellor Bingham. The chancellor acts as the head bureaucrat of the town, and it is customary for people seeking work, shelter or trade within the town to first be introduced to the chancellor, since it’s a small town that relies upon community to survive. While the party is introducing itself, a messenger arrives and informs the chancellor that the city has been placed under siege by a strange, massive creature, and it seems as though they only have a few hours to kill it before the creature breaks through and begins laying waste to the town. The chancellor asks for the party’s help since they’re already on hand. He says they can either go rally the guards across town, take a credit for two magic items to Mistress Argua’s shop and use the items to slay the beast, or convince Tinkerer John to deploy the automaton he’s been working on to defend the city. The players can do some of or all of these tasks, though there’s only time to fully succeed at one or partially succeed at two. The party then proceeds to the walls and fights off the Tainted Treant and save the town, being rewarded with an immensely powerful magic sword.
